EXCELLENT PICTURE (even at night) BUY THESE CAMERAS!
So I have been using the Yi 1080p indoor camera system for 2 weeks now and I LOVE IT! The camera's are crystal clear during the day and are just as sharp in night mode. The added features of being able to hide any "lights" such as the blue power light and the typical red IR lights for night vision makes "hiding" these cameras a breeze. The playback function works great and give you the time in hours, minutes & seconds. The 2 way talk feature works great and has 2 modes, 1 is a push to talk feature where when you press the button you cannot hear what the person on the camera is saying and the 2nd is a continuous talk where you and the person on the camera can talk back and forth without pressing any buttons (love this feature) the 32gig on board storage is also a great bonus. Like I said I have been using the cameras for about 2 weeks and have barely used 3 gigs of space. (for an idea of the amount of traffic, it's just me, my wife and our 2 pets) so the cameras don't get a ton of action during the week. But are always recording on any motion. (I do not subscribe to the cloud storage as for I haven't seen a need) Anytime you get an alert it will store it on the app and you can upload it to your mobile device and share it with others. The initial motion detection clip is only 6 seconds, but if you wait till the end of the 6 seconds you will get an option to "view entire motion" which will bring up that camera, rewind to when it first detected the motion and play it back until there is no longer any motion, GREAT feature. All of the features seem to work as expected, you can set times for your camera to alert you when it detects motion and zones so that your dog walking around doesn't keep triggering the alerts. I can say the motion detection is VERY sensitive. You can set the setting to low, medium or high but really I can't tell a difference low to high. I have one camera facing out of my front window and it picks up shadows, car lights, leaves blowing, etc. Not a big deal, but on a windy day I can get a ton of alerts. The app works great, you can set a PIN or use your fingerprint to log into the cameras so in the event your phone is stolen, unless they have your PIN or fingerprint they will not be able to pull up your cameras. Connecting them was very simple and took less than 5 minutes per camera. Plug them in, scan the UR code and they will automatically connect to the network your phone is connected to. The packaging was very nice, didn't feel cheap. All cameras were individually wrapped along with all of the accessories. Comes with instruction booklet for assistance with installing/setup. The camera (black part) can be removed from the white base and mounted in different areas. They also sell (separately) wall mounts for the cameras. (cheap, like $10-$15 for a 4 pack) or you can stand them up anywhere you like (they have a round rubber grip on the bottom to help keep them from sliding around. All 4 cameras come with a USB cord and power brick. The USB cord is about 10-12 feet long so you should be able to place these cameras wherever you'd like.
